Music for Motown Kids strives to bring affordable music education to Detroit's youth. Music is a proven teaching tool for boosting student achievement. Our school culture at the MSU Community Music School-Detroit engages youth and whole families in learning music and teaches skills such as dedication, teamwork, creativity, problem-solving and abstract thinking. Our faculty is caring and dedicated to mentoring Detroit's musical legacy with the next generation.

The Aspiring Musicians Program (AMP) offers beginning and intermediate instrumental music lessons to Detroit youth ages 9 through 17 in small group classes on brass, winds, strings, percussion, piano and guitar. Although our subsidized lessons average $5 per week, many of our families still need financial aid in order to participate. Our formula for providing tuition assistance is based on Federal Poverty Guidelines.


 

Detroit's median household income in the most recent U.S. Census was $26,955. According to the Annie E. Casey Foundation, 57.3% of all Detroit children, ages 0-17, live below the poverty level.
